What are some good end of the year activities?

I have twelve 7th graders and two hours. Take away time for morning devotions, what activites could I do to finish out the year in a fun and reflective way? Also, what kind of questions would be good to have for a "survey" about the school year?

  2. Have the students write a letter about their 7th grade experience. The audience will be your next year's class. It is so fun to see what they say. You could have a theme, like, tell the new class the best way to get good grades, tell them your funniest moment in school..... As far as the survey....it is always good to do pre/post. But in this case, you could ask, anonymously... grading policy favorite class and why favorite project What are their fears about 8th grade what are they looking forward to summer plans best field trip
